2025 PGA Championship: Scottie Scheffler Claims Victory and record $3.42M Prize at Quail Hollow

Tournament Overview


Scottie Scheffler dominated the 2025 PGA Championship at Quail Hollow Club,securing a six-stroke victory over runners-up Bryson DeChambeau,Harris English,and Davis Riley. This marks SchefflerS third major championship victory and his first major win outside Augusta National.

Prize Money Distribution


The tournament featured a record-breaking $19 million purse,representing a $500,000 increase from 2024. Scheffler’s victory earned him $3.42 million, while the three runners-up each received $1,418,667. All players making the cut earned a minimum of $23,420, with the top 32 finishers securing six-figure paydays.

Historical Importance


The 2025 PGA Championship purse reflects the tournament’s significant financial growth, having nearly doubled over the past decade from approximately $10 million in 2014. The winner’s share now represents almost one-third of the total purse from that era, highlighting the PGA of America’s continued investment in it’s flagship event.
